Stimulus checks returned to IRS

Yes, if the checks were sent back, they never received the amount. The IRS is not going to hold the checks and try to find the Taxpayers. The only way now to get the first and/or second stimulus payments that were not received is to file a 2020 tax return and claim the Recovery Credit. 

 

TO GET TO THE STIMULUS SECTION OF TURBOTAX:

Go into your account and click "Tax Home"

On that screen click "Other Tax Situations"

When the drop-down opens, click "Let's Get Started" or "Review/Edit" to move forward 

There may be a delay when opening to this next screen

Scroll to the bottom of this screen and click "Let's keep going" 

The next screen should read "Let's make sure you got the right stimulus amount" (If not, click continue to move forward until you do get to that screen)

Scroll down and click "Continue"

The next screens will ask if you received the stimulus, which ones and how much. 

The software will calculate a credit if applicable.
